39 "Happy Hour" restaurants in Miami.
Melinda’s is a bar and restaurant in Downtown. Their patio is a good place to have a few drinks and some food before a night out.
New Yorker Patio Bar is a casual outdoor bar in MiMo. It’s located in the back of a boutique hotel and works for having a laid-back drink or two.
Ella's Oyster Bar is a casual seafood restaurant on the main strip of Calle Ocho. They've got oysters (obviously) and lots of seafood options.
The Wharf is a crowded waterfront bar on the Miami River. It's loud, mostly outside, and there are food trucks.
Phuc Yea in MiMo serves massive portions of pho, curries, and more mostly Vietnamese dishes that are fun to share with a group.
Tomorrowland is a mostly outdoor bar in Downtown that works for Happy Hour or really any time you want to drink outside.
The Abbey is a little pub that’s surprisingly divey (in a good way) for being located on Lincoln Road.
The ScapeGoat is a very small cocktail bar in South of Fifth that can get rowdy on weekends, but is pretty chill during Happy Hour.
Minibar is a little hotel bar in South of Fifth that has a good happy hour, some outdoor seating, and fantastic wallpaper.
Coyo Taco is a casual taco shop with multiple locations throughout Miami, and the tacos are definitely worth waiting in line.
River Oyster Bar is one of the best restaurants in Brickell where you can have a nice sit-down dinner or some Happy Hour oysters at the bar.
Veza Sur is a Wynwood brewery where you can sit outside and relax with some good beer. There's usually a food truck out back too.
American Social is an upscale sports bar and restaurant in Brickell. It’s a good spot to watch college football or eat by the water.
Boater's Grill is a casual seafood spot inside Bill Baggs State Park. It has a really nice view of the water too.
Casablanca is a casual seafood spot on the Miami River. Most of the seating is outdoor waterfront tables, which is exactly why you come here.
